2 What are Pink Dolphins ? ‏Pink dolphins ( 白海豚 ) are related to the humpback dolphins. They are usually grey or blue in colour. Only those around China ( 中華白海豚 ) have naturally pink skin due to the blood flowing close to the top of the skin.

3 Appearance Measures 2.2 to 3 m long, although the males are usually larger Weighs between 100 -230 kg. The Pink Dolphin's tale is relatively big and it has 2 flippers. It has small eyes. The Pink Dolphin can turn its head completely round, due to it’s un-fused vertebrae.

4 Habitat They are found in most places around Southeast Asia, but their have been sightings from South Africa to Australia. Here in China, they mostly reside in the Pearl River Estuary and between the sea and the rivers North Lantau is popular for it’s dolphin watch

5 Reproduction Chinese White Dolphins generally live in groups of 3-4 They mature between the ages of 10 -13 They mate from the end of summer to autumn. Young are born after 10-11 months and are taken care of until able to hunt themselves. Females can give birth every three years or so The average White Dolphin can live up to 40 years

6 Increasing Dangers Boats (ferries, dinghies, etc) are disrupting their daily lives Pollution in the form of garbage cause bacteria and then infections Landfills are leaving dolphins stranded away from their homes Overfishing is reducing the amount of prey for the dolphins and the government do not have laws restricting amount or size of fish
